Documentation

It's important to note that just as in an auto accident you can seek out compensation for medical bills and other losses following a boating accident. The amount of money you may receive can cover a variety of expenses which include doctors' visits, X-rays, prescriptions and physical therapy as well as the loss of income resulting from being disabled to work.

If you're in a position to do so it's a good idea capture photos of the scene of the boating accident as well as any visible injuries. It's also an excellent idea to collect the contact details of witnesses and anyone on any of the boats involved in the crash. This will assist you in establishing your case in the event that you have to file a lawsuit against an liable party.

In a personal injury case, there are four elements that you must prove: the defendant owed the duty of care to you, they breached this duty, that their breach caused your injury or damages, and that your injuries and damages resulted from that incident. In a case involving a boat, you may be able to name more than one defendant as responsible for the boating accident, based on the level of negligence they displayed and their role in the incident.

You should never apologize or admit responsibility for an accident. This could undermine the investigation and also your claim for compensation for injuries sustained by boating.

Insurance Coverage

New Yorkers are used to boating and other water sports because of their accessibility to the Atlantic Ocean, numerous lakes and other bodies of water. But this recreational activity brings with it unique liabilities that should be considered seriously. If you've been injured as a result of a boating accident you should seek out an attorney for personal injuries.

An attorney can assist you determine the insurance coverage available for your case. The majority of boat owners and operators have liability insurance to cover injuries caused by their actions. If the other party doesn't have insurance, or is underinsured, you may be entitled to additional compensation.

Check your boat's insurance policy to ensure that it is current and provides coverage for your boat. Generally speaking, these policies provide medical payment insurance that will cover first aid treatment hospital bills, as well as other expenses if you or anyone else is injured on your boat. The policies usually also provide a towing protection that covers on-site labor and towing expenses up to the limits you set if your boat becomes disabled on the water.

Physical damage coverage can include agreed value loss settlement that will pay the full amount of your policy in total loss circumstances, or actual cash value, that is the current market value of your boat, less depreciation. Some policies offer pollution (spill) liability along with pet and wreck removal coverage too.
